Lopholithodes mandtii

Distribution

    Substrate and environment

    • Exclusively a marine species
    • The species is generally observed on the reef or near it.
    • The species is generally motionless in its environment
    • The species is generally found on or close to the seafloor.
    • The species can be found between 0 and 140 Meters.
    • Uncommon Species
    • Imitates a rock or a coral.

    General behaviour of the species

    • Species generally solitary
    • Imitates a rock or a coral.
    • The animal is rather indifferent to the diver, though it remains on its guard

    General characteristics of the species

    • Maximum size : 30 cm
    • The animal is a hunter low in the food chain.
    • Diet : Sea urchins - Sea stars - Sea cucumbers

    Relationship with humans

    • Pinches can be very painful
    • The species is good to eat
    • The species is exploited in the following sector(s) :
      • - Fishing or commercial aquiculture for food
      • -Sport or local fishing
    • The species is classified asVulnerable
